Alan King hopes Invictus can emulate Voy Por Ustedes after his victory at Plumpton on Monday set up a possible tilt at a Cheltenham Festival bonus.
A total of STG60,000 ($A91,968) is on offer for any horse who can win at Plumpton and then follow up at Prestbury Park in March.
King was the last trainer to achieve the feat with subsequent Arkle winner Voy Por Ustedes during the 2005/06 campaign.
Invictus maintained his unbeaten record over fences with an impressive success on Monday, beating solid Irish yardstick Gift of Dgab by 10 lengths.
“The bonus is certainly an option, but we’ll have to see what the handicapper does and plan where we go next with him,” King said.
“His work is a whole lot better this year. We were delighted with him at Hereford and obviously delighted with him yesterday. He seems to be on the up at the moment.
“I think the Irish horse ran off a mark off 149 yesterday so you couldn’t have asked for any more. He put it to bed very quickly on the bottom bend.
“We’ll try and find a race over the Festive period, possibly the Dipper at Cheltenham on New Year’s Day,” he told At The Races.
